DigiTest® Measurement Nodes are deployed within
networks worldwide, providing the foundation
for switch-based metallic testing. The node
is a one-rack-unit-high chassis that houses
up to two plug-in modules, enabling it to be
configured for various narrowband and wideband
testing applications.
The Digital Measurement Unit Plus (DMU+) plug-in
incorporates the latest in Tollgrade testing
technology and builds upon the considerable
legacy of its forerunner, the DMU. It includes
a rich set of testing functions, built-in no-test
trunk (NTT) signaling and the option to add
a Loop Insertion Loss (LIL) module to perform
accurate, single-ended insertion loss measurements
at critical DSL frequencies using the Class
5 switch testing fabric.
A DMU+ can also be complemented with a Digital
Wideband Unit (DWU) to perform a broad array
of wideband measurements.
The LoopCare LIL
Feature, when used in conjunction with the
DigiTest DMU+ test head, performs insertion
loss measurements using an innovative technique
that can successfully test a given loop’s
ability to support the high frequencies associated
with ADSL and ADSL2+ services using the limited
narrowband frequency response of most Class
5 switches. As a result, this single-ended
insertion loss measurement serves as a highly
accurate prediction of actual DSL connect speeds.
